{KXLG – Watertown, SD} The Watertown Regional Airport is moving closer to securing $3.6 million through the Federal Aviation Administration’s Voluntary Airport Low Emissions (VALE) program to construct parking lot carports equipped with solar panels.
The VALE program has traditionally been limited to airports serving larger population areas, but recent changes to the program made Watertown eligible to apply for funding.
If approved, the project would install solar panels on carport structures in the airport parking lot. Airport officials say the project could significantly reduce monthly utility costs while also providing travelers with some protection from the elements when parking their vehicles.
The Watertown Regional Airport’s utility expenses typically range from $7,000 to $12,000 per month, depending on the season and energy usage. Airport leaders say generating solar power on-site could help greatly lower those costs and improve the airport’s long-term energy efficiency.
The project also aligns with city and airport goals to promote sustainability, manage operational expenses, and support future aviation growth without increasing fees for airport tenants or users.
The next steps include finalizing FAA approval and, if approved, beginning the bidding process for the project.
Meanwhile, the airport continues to see strong passenger growth. The Watertown Regional Airport recorded 1,434 enplanements in May; a 19 percent increase compared to the same month last year.
Denver service accounted for 823 travelers, representing a 66 percent increase over 2025 levels. Service through Minneapolis-St. Paul recorded 611 passengers; a 27 percent increase compared to the airport’s Chicago service during fiscal year 2025.
